3 The differences: BritishAmerican 2. irony Irony virtually runs in the blood of Brits, they use it as a way of mocking their enemies, play fighting with friends, and laughing at themselves. It is used much less in everyday life and it is generally seen as inappropriate in situations where it is normal in the UK. Many Americans who use irony often add an "only joking" to the end of an ironic statement (which kills the irony).

4 The differences: BritishAmerican 3. farce British jokes tend to be more subtle but with a dark or sarcastic undertone. Jokes are more obvious and forward, a bit like Americans themselves.
